No further details has been revealed about the crossover episode which is scheduled to air on March 28.

"Supergirl" stars Melissa Benoist as Kara Zor-El, who escapes the destruction on Krypton to join her cousin on Earth.

also stars  Mehcad Brooks, Calista Flockhart, Chyler Leigh, David Harewood, Faran Tahir, Dean Cain and Helen Slater.

"The Flash" stars Grant Gustin as Barry Allen/The Flash,Candice Patton as Iris West, Rick Cosnett as Eddie Thawne, Danielle Panabaker as Caitlin Snow, Carlos Valdes as Cisco Ramon, Jesse L. Martin as Detective Joe West, Teddy Sears as Jay Garrick, Keiynan Lonsdale as Wally West, Shantel VanSanten as Patty Spivot,Violett Beane as Jesse Quick, Demore Barnes as Tokamak, and Tony Todd as Zoom.
